Starbucks (SBUX) Stock Moves -0.06%: What You Should Know

Read MoreHide Full Article

In the latest trading session, Starbucks (SBUX - Free Report) closed at $97.43, marking a -0.06% move from the previous day. The stock's change was more than the S&P 500's daily loss of 0.93%. On the other hand, the Dow registered a loss of 0.41%, and the technology-centric Nasdaq decreased by 1.53%.

The coffee chain's shares have seen an increase of 3.09% over the last month, not keeping up with the Retail-Wholesale sector's gain of 5.61% and outstripping the S&P 500's gain of 2.17%.

Investors will be eagerly watching for the performance of Starbucks in its upcoming earnings disclosure. It is anticipated that the company will report an EPS of $1.04, marking a 1.89% fall compared to the same quarter of the previous year. At the same time, our most recent consensus estimate is projecting a revenue of $9.35 billion, reflecting a 0.22% fall from the equivalent quarter last year.

Within the past 30 days, our consensus EPS projection has moved 0.02% lower. Starbucks is currently sporting a Zacks Rank of #4 (Sell).

In terms of valuation, Starbucks is currently trading at a Forward P/E ratio of 27.41. This indicates a premium in contrast to its industry's Forward P/E of 22.17.

It is also worth noting that SBUX currently has a PEG ratio of 2.33. Comparable to the widely accepted P/E ratio, the PEG ratio also accounts for the company's projected earnings growth. Retail - Restaurants stocks are, on average, holding a PEG ratio of 2.19 based on yesterday's closing prices.

The Retail - Restaurants industry is part of the Retail-Wholesale sector. At present, this industry carries a Zacks Industry Rank of 166, placing it within the bottom 35% of over 250 industries.
